Understanding the Romanian Real Estate Market

The first step in creating a robust real estate investment strategy Romania foreign individuals can adopt is developing a thorough understanding of the local market dynamics. Romania has witnessed a resurgence in its property market, especially in major cities such as Bucharest, Cluj-Napoca, and Timișoara. The demand for residential, commercial, and industrial properties is on the rise as a result of urbanization, growing population, and economic growth.

Foreign investors must analyze various factors, such as the economic outlook, consumer trends, rental yields, and property prices in different regions. Analyzing these metrics can provide valuable insights into where to invest for optimal returns.

Navigating Legal and Regulatory Framework

A critical aspect of a real estate investment strategy in Romania for foreign investors is ensuring compliance with local laws and regulations. While Romania welcomes foreign investment, understanding the legal landscape is essential to ensure a smooth investment experience. Key considerations include:

1. Legal Structures: Foreign entities typically invest in Romanian real estate through a local company or as private individuals. Consulting with legal experts to choose the best structure is advised.
2. Ownership Regulations: Familiarize yourself with the rights and obligations of property ownership, particularly for foreigners. There are certain restrictions on agricultural land ownership that may apply.
3. Taxation: Understanding local taxation laws is crucial. The Romanian tax system includes property taxes, income tax on rental properties, and capital gains tax on property sales. Get advice from tax professionals to optimize your investment from a tax perspective.
4. Contracts and Transactions: Ensure that you have legal assistance to draft and review contracts, as real estate transactions can involve lengthy and complex paperwork.

Financing Your Investment

Your investment strategy will require a clear financing plan. This may involve utilizing personal savings, traditional mortgages, or investment loans. Understanding the various financing options available to foreign investors in Romania will greatly enhance your strategy.

1. Mortgages: Romanian banks offer a range of financing options, including mortgages for foreign investors. Research various banks to understand their lending criteria, interest rates, and terms.
2. Partnership Opportunities: Consider partnering with local investors or syndicates to spread the financial risk. Joint ventures can also provide valuable local expertise.
3. Alternative Financing: Evaluate options like crowdfunding platforms or private lenders that specialize in real estate investments.
